An Investigation of Multitask Linear Genetic Programming for Dynamic Job Shop Scheduling

被引:9
|
作者
Huang, Zhixing [1 ]
Zhang, Fangfang [1 ]
Mei, Yi [1 ]
Zhang, Mengjie [1 ]
机构
[1] Victoria Univ Wellington, Sch Engn & Comp Sci, POB 600, Wellington 6140, New Zealand
关键词
Multitask; Linear genetic programming; Hyper-heuristic; Dynamic job shop scheduling; HEURISTICS;
D O I
10.1007/978-3-031-02056-8_11
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Dynamic job shop scheduling has a wide range of applications in reality such as order picking in warehouse. Using genetic programming to design scheduling heuristics for dynamic job shop scheduling problems becomes increasingly common In recent years, multitask genetic programming-based hyper-heuristic methods have been developed to solve similar dynamic scheduling problem scenarios simultaneously. However, all of the existing studies focus on the tree-based genetic programming. In this paper, we investigate the use of linear genetic programming, which has some advantages over tree-based genetic programming in designing multitask methods, such as building block reusing. Specifically, this paper makes a preliminary investigation on several issues of multitask linear genetic programming. The experiments show that the linear genetic programming within multitask frameworks have a significantly better performance than solving tasks separately, by sharing useful building blocks.
引用
收藏
页码:162 / 178
页数:17
相关论文
共 50 条
  • [41] Learning iterative dispatching rules for job shop scheduling with genetic programming
    Su Nguyen
    Zhang, Mengjie
    Johnston, Mark
    Tan, Kay Chen
    INTERNATIONAL JOURNAL OF ADVANCED MANUFACTURING TECHNOLOGY, 2013, 67 (1-4): : 85 - 100
  • [42] Learning iterative dispatching rules for job shop scheduling with genetic programming
    Su Nguyen
    Mengjie Zhang
    Mark Johnston
    Kay Chen Tan
    The International Journal of Advanced Manufacturing Technology, 2013, 67 : 85 - 100
  • [43] Learning iterative dispatching rules for job shop scheduling with genetic programming
    Nguyen, S. (su.nguyen@ecs.vuw.ac.nz), 1600, Springer London (67): : 1 - 4
  • [44] Many-Objective Genetic Programming for Job-Shop Scheduling
    Masood, Atiya
    Mei, Yi
    Chen, Gang
    Zhang, Mengjie
    2016 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), 2016, : 209 - 216
  • [45] Solving the job-shop scheduling problem optimally by dynamic programming
    Gromicho, Joaquim A. S.
    van Hoorn, Jelke J.
    Saldanha-da-Gama, Francisco
    Timmer, Gerrit T.
    COMPUTERS & OPERATIONS RESEARCH, 2012, 39 (12) : 2968 - 2977
  • [46] A Coevolution Genetic Programming Method to Evolve Scheduling Policies for Dynamic Multi-objective Job Shop Scheduling Problems
    Su Nguyen
    Zhang, Mengjie
    Johnston, Mark
    Tan, Kay Chen
    2012 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), 2012,
  • [47] Dynamic scheduling strategy of job shop based on parallel evolutionary programming
    Weng, Miaofeng
    Xiaoxing Weixing Jisuanji Xitong/Mini-Micro Systems, 2000, 21 (06): : 620 - 622
  • [48] Dynamic Scheduling of Flexible Job Shop Based on Genetic Algorithm
    Yu, Tianbiao
    Zhou, Jing
    Fang, Junhua
    Gong, Yadong
    Wang, Wanshan
    2008 IEEE INTERNATIONAL CONFERENCE ON AUTOMATION AND LOGISTICS, VOLS 1-6, 2008, : 2014 - 2019
  • [49] Genetic Programming Based Hyper-heuristics for Dynamic Job Shop Scheduling: Cooperative Coevolutionary Approaches
    Park, John
    Mei, Yi
    Nguyen, Su
    Chen, Gang
    Johnston, Mark
    Zhang, Mengjie
    GENETIC PROGRAMMING, EUROGP 2016, 2016, 9594 : 115 - 132
  • [50] Collaborative Multifidelity-Based Surrogate Models for Genetic Programming in Dynamic Flexible Job Shop Scheduling
    Zhang, Fangfang
    Mei, Yi
    Nguyen, Su
    Zhang, Mengjie
    IEEE TRANSACTIONS ON CYBERNETICS, 2022, 52 (08) : 8142 - 8156